Gastronomic Tour: Flavors and Tradition of Mexico City's Historic Center

We invite you to an authentic immersion in Mexico City's Historic Center through its flavors. We will walk its centuries-old streets and vibrant markets, tasting more than seven local samples. Discover the history and culture behind every taco, tlacoyo, and fresh water you try. This three-hour walk is the ideal way to experience the heart of the capital like a true local.

What to expect

Meeting point: Mexico City Zócalo

Meet the guide outside the Zócalo Cathedral, where we will give a brief historical introduction to the Historic Center and the tasting route.

10 Minutes
Market of Flavors and Fruits

Explore a local market to taste fresh juices and seasonal fruits, learning about the basic ingredients of Mexican cuisine.

30 Minutes
The Corner of Antojitos

Visit a hidden traditional eatery to try Mexican snacks like tlacoyos or quesadillas. This is the first main course of the tour.

40 Minutes
Masterclass on Tacos

A must-stop to try the iconic tacos al pastor and tacos de canasta, with an explanation of the cooking technique and the variety of sauces.

38 Minutes
Cultural Tasting and Dessert

Walk to a historic square to sample a variety of traditional desserts such as paletas, oaxaquitas, or handmade sweets.

30 Minutes
Closing and Questions

End of the tour. Time for final questions, guide tips, and farewell to the group.

10 Minutes
